Attock Group cricket team

Attock Group were a first-class cricket team sponsored by the Attock Group of Companies in Rawalpindi, Pakistan. They played in the 2006-07 season, competing in the Patron's Trophy.

Playing record

After winning the Patron's Trophy Grade-II competition in 2005-06 under the name of Attock Refinery Limited, Attock Group were promoted to the first-class division for 2006-07. Most of their players came from the Rawalpindi area, including the captain, Babar Naeem.[1]

Attock Group played four matches, losing two and drawing two, and finished at the bottom of their group.[2] They have not played first-class cricket since.

The highest score was 152 not out by Imran Ali.[3] The best bowling figures were 6 for 92 by Asim Butt.[4]
